Transaction dc65d3372887db8f1882251291aa171d1053aa32e9989bf97d7d865f155f5cda
1 Input
1 Output
-
dc65d3372887db8f1882251291aa171d1053aa32e9989bf97d7d865f155f5cda:0
- value
- 598252
- script pubkey
- OP_0 OP_PUSHBYTES_20 c29f604b3f35f771110b211ff218333d273ac21a
- address
- bc1qc20kqjelxhmhzygtyy0lyxpn85nn4ss6jdvegv